响应式网站设计已成为现代企业数字化转型的核心需求。本文将从定义响应式网站的关键特性出发,深入探讨如何寻找高质量案例分析资源,识别不同场景下的设计挑战,分析技术实现与优化策略,评估用户体验影响,并总结可落地的解决方案,帮助企业快速掌握响应式设计的很新趋势与实践。
一、定义响应式网站的关键特性
响应式网站设计的核心在于自适应布局,即网站能够根据用户设备的屏幕尺寸、分辨率和操作方式自动调整布局和内容展示。以下是响应式网站的关键特性:
- 流体网格布局:使用百分比而非固定像素定义布局,确保页面元素能够灵活缩放。
- 弹性图片与媒体:通过CSS或JavaScript实现图片和视频的自适应缩放,避免内容溢出或失真。
- 媒体查询(Media Queries):根据设备特性(如屏幕宽度、方向)动态调整样式,提供挺好显示效果。
- 触摸友好设计:针对移动设备优化交互元素(如按钮大小、间距),提升触控体验。
从实践来看,响应式设计不仅是技术实现,更是一种以用户为中心的思维方式。企业需要根据目标用户群体的设备使用习惯,制定相应的设计策略。
二、寻找高质量案例分析的资源渠道
要找到很新的响应式网站案例分析,可以从以下渠道入手:
- 设计社区与博客:如Smashing Magazine、Awwwards、CSS-Tricks等,这些平台定期发布高质量的案例分析和技术文章。
- 开源项目与代码库:GitHub、CodePen等平台上有大量响应式设计的开源项目,可直接查看代码实现。
- 行业报告与白皮书:如Google的《移动优先索引指南》、Adobe的《数字体验趋势报告》,提供很新的设计趋势和数据支持。
- 企业官网与案例库:许多知名企业(如Airbnb、Spotify)会公开其设计案例,供行业参考。
我认为,结合理论与实践是学习响应式设计的挺好方式。通过分析真实案例,可以更直观地理解设计原则和技术实现。
三、识别不同场景下的响应式设计挑战
在不同场景下,响应式设计可能面临以下挑战:
- 多设备兼容性:不同设备的屏幕尺寸、分辨率和性能差异较大,如何确保一致的用户体验?
- 内容优先级:在小屏幕设备上,如何合理展示核心内容,避免信息过载?
- 性能优化:响应式设计可能导致加载速度变慢,如何平衡设计与性能?
- 跨浏览器兼容性:不同浏览器对CSS和JavaScript的支持程度不同,如何确保兼容性?
从实践来看,用户测试与数据分析是解决这些挑战的关键。通过收集用户反馈和设备使用数据,可以更有针对性地优化设计。
四、分析案例中的技术实现与优化策略
在案例分析中,重点关注以下技术实现与优化策略:
- CSS框架的使用:如Bootstrap、Tailwind CSS等,提供现成的响应式布局组件,加速开发。
- 图片优化技术:使用WebP格式、懒加载(Lazy Loading)和响应式图片(srcset)减少加载时间。
- JavaScript性能优化:通过代码分割(Code Splitting)和异步加载(Async Loading)提升页面响应速度。
- 渐进式增强(Progressive Enhancement):确保基础功能在所有设备上可用,再为高端设备提供增强体验。
我认为,技术选型与团队协作是成功实现响应式设计的关键。企业应根据项目需求和团队能力,选择合适的技术栈。
五、评估响应式设计对用户体验的影响
响应式设计对用户体验的影响主要体现在以下几个方面:
- 一致性:用户在不同设备上获得一致的品牌体验,增强信任感。
- 便捷性:无需为不同设备开发独立版本,降低用户学习成本。
- 可访问性:通过优化布局和交互,提升残障用户的访问体验。
- 转化率:良好的响应式设计可以显著提升用户留存率和转化率。
从实践来看,数据驱动的优化是提升用户体验的有效手段。通过A/B测试和用户行为分析,可以不断优化设计细节。
六、总结并应用解决方案到实际项目中
要将响应式设计成功应用到实际项目中,建议遵循以下步骤:
- 明确目标与需求:根据业务目标和用户需求,制定响应式设计策略。
- 选择合适工具与技术:结合团队能力和项目复杂度,选择合适的技术栈。
- 持续测试与优化:通过用户测试和数据分析,不断优化设计细节。
- 关注行业趋势:定期学习很新的设计趋势和技术,保持竞争力。
响应式网站设计不仅是技术实现,更是以用户为中心的设计思维。通过分析高质量案例,识别设计挑战,优化技术实现,并评估用户体验影响,企业可以快速掌握响应式设计的核心要点。在实际项目中,建议结合数据驱动的优化和行业趋势,持续提升设计水平,为用户提供无缝的多设备体验。
原创文章,作者:IT_admin,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/288786